Abstract

Since the publication of Satoshi Nakamoto's white paper on Bitcoin in 2008, blockchain has (slowly) become one of the most frequently discussed methods for securing data storage and transfer through decentralized, trust-less, peer-to-peer systems. With the accelerated iteration of technological innovation, blockchain has rapidly become one of the hottest Internet technologies in recent years. As a decentralized and distributed data management solution, blockchain has restored the definition of trust by the embedded cryptography and consensus mechanism, thus providing security, anonymity and data integrity without the need of any third party. But there still exists some technical challenges and limitations in blockchain. The blockchain, with its own characteristics, has received much attention at the beginning of its birth and been applied in many fields.Voting is a very important process that takes place in almost every country of the world and many efforts have been made to improve the process over the years. In this report, the process of building an electronic voting system has been chalked out using Blockchain Technology. This new system will not only make the whole process much fairer but will also greatly reduce the time and workforce spent over it. This paper explains the prospects on which we can improve and also talks about the limitations of the system. An experimental set-up is also carried out with a proper result analysis to show the efficiency of the E-Voting System over the traditional process of voting.
